They do essentially mean the same thing as statements on their own. The subtle difference is that using "have" ("we've") focuses on the present state of having found someone, whereas using just "we found" focuses more on the actual past event of finding someone. WebNov 29, 2024 · Remember, “find” is an irregular verb, so in the present, we say “find,” in the past, we say “found,” and using the past participle, we say “have found” ( source ). Example sentences: If you find a good Thai restaurant near the school, let me know. I found my purse. It fell behind my car seat. Mary hasn’t found her dogs yet. I hope she does soon.
